31
90
16
390
7
6
21
45
13
8
56
11
165
54
104
161
52
42
69
15
182
108
80
225
125
27
58
250
37
5129
244
120
36
435
166
41
49
64
305
270
220
47
35
66
113
77
105
81
22
100
67
74
78